vunion <- function (x, y, multiple=TRUE) {
# 'multiple' = FALSE is normal union
if (multiple) {
# (max()) is 4X faster than this
# trueun <- c(vintersect(x,y), vsetdiff(x,y), vsetdiff(y,x) )
# but have to remove NA values to avoid disaster
x <- as.vector(x)
y <- as.vector(y)
xx <- x[!is.na(x)]
xn <- length(x) - length(xx) #x[is.na(x)]
yy <- y[!is.na(y)]
yn <- length(y) - length(yy) # y[is.na(y)]
# here I want the max of how many NA there are
ndif <- max(xn,yn)
uniqs <- sort(unique(c(xx,yy))) #makes output pretty
trueun <- vector()
for (ju in 1:length(uniqs)) {
trueun <- c(trueun, rep(uniqs[ju],times = max(sum(xx==uniqs[ju]), sum(yy==uniqs[ju]) ) ) )
}
# now put NAs back in
trueun <- c(trueun,rep(NA,ndif))
return(trueun)
} else return(union(x,y))
}
